PESHAWAR: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Chamber of Commerce and Industry (KPCCI) appreciated the federal government decision for giving approval regarding establishment of Expo Centre in Peshawar.
The centre will be established at cost of over Rs 2 billion. For the project, seed money of Rs 500 million has been allocated in Public Sector Development Scheme (PSDP) by the federal government in the current financial year 2015-16, this was revealed by KPCCI president Faud Ishaq while speaking at meeting of the chamber executive committee.
He urged the federal government for early initiation of work on the important scheme. He extended special thanks to Prime Minister Mian Nawaz Sharif, Federal Minister for Commerce, Engr Khurram Dastgir, Federal Secretary Commerce Muhammad Shahzad Arbab for approval of funds regarding establishment of Expo Centre in Peshawar. He said the Centre would play vital role for showcasing and promotion of locally manufacturing products at international market, besides would create job opportunities for many people.
Senator Ilyas Bilour while speaking on the occasion thanked the federal government for announcement of five year tax-holidays for Khyber Pakhtunkhwa businesses through the federal fiscal budget 2015-16. He expressed the hope that with exemption of turnover, income taxes, along with other incentives, would promote trade and industries in KP.
He also appreciated the federal government for giving approval of establishing Expo Centre in Peshawar and said the outgoing president of KPCCI, had played pivotal role for fresh tax-exemption, along with resolution of old issue regarding turnover tax and setting up Expo Centre in provincial capital.
